Ethiopia Invite 26 Players To Camp
Published: December 06, 2012
Ahead of the 2013 African Cup of Nations in South Africa, the Ethiopia Football Federation has invited 26 local players to camp, writes ethiosports.com
St. George, the Premier League defending champions have contributed 10 players while Dedebit FC have 9 players on the roster.
The Super Eagles are in Group C of the Nations Cup and will battle Ethiopia, Zambia and Burkina Faso for a quarter final ticket. Nigeria meets Ethiopia in her final group game on January 29th at Rustenburg, North - West South Africa.
Invited Players
St. George (10): Degu Abebe, Biadgelegn Elias, Abebaw Butako, Shemelis Bekele, Adane Girma, Oumed Oukri, Fitsum Gebre-Mariam, Alula Girma, Yared Zenabu, Zerihun Tadele, Zerihun Tadele.
Dedebit FC (9): Sisay Bancha, Getaneh Kebede, Berhanu Bogale, Aynalem Hailu, Seyoum Tesfaye, Aklilu Ayenew, Addis Hintsa, Menyahel Teshome, Behailu Assefa,
Ethiopian Coffee (2): Jemal Tassew & Dawit Estifanos
EEPCO (1): Asrat Megersa
Commercial Bank (1): Fikru Tefferi
Sebeta Kenema (1): Dereje Alemu
Defence Force (1): Medhane Tadesse
Arba Minch (1): Mulualem Mesfin
